Request by Public Health Services for approval to accept from the Texas Health and Human Services Commission grant funds in the amount of $10,914,395, with no required match, for the FY27 Women, Infants, and Children Program, and extend 111 associated positions to September 30, 2027.
Harris County seeks approval to accept $10.9M in state WIC grant funds and extend 111 positions through September 2027.
Harris County Public Health Services is asking the Commissioners Court to approve a grant of $10,914,395 from the Texas Health and Human Services Commission. The funds would support the Women, Infants, and Children (WIC) Program for fiscal year 2027 and extend 111 staff positions through September 30, 2027. No matching funds are required from the county.
This vote decides whether Harris County can keep receiving $10.9 million in state grant money for a food and health program. It also decides whether 111 county workers keep their jobs through September 2027.
